I still do tapered wings the old way. Cut Fuse bottom out making cuts at an angle. I also have the flaps already on the wing. Once wing is in place, glue the cut section back in place. Use ply scab over the inside of the cut.
Now once wing is in place with some glue and doesn't move, I take strips of fiber glass and epoxy glue on the inside fuse wing joint. Being as I also have the bell crank posts sticking above and below the wing surface I put my ply plates over the post ends before doing the fiber glass on the wing/fuse joint. So far no failures.
